NETStudy 2.0 UEID Issue Reported

On January 8, 2026 by Mark Schulz

The Minnesota Department of Human Services (DHS) has reported an error in NETStudy 2.0 affecting the system’s ability to generate and update Universal Enrollment Identification numbers (UEIDs) for recently submitted applications. The UEID is the individual-specific tracking number issued by the fingerprint vendor IDEMIA and is required to complete fingerprinting.

Webinar for Providers: Elderly Waiver Hospital High-Needs Budget Exception

On January 8, 2026 by Bobbie Guidry

The 2024 Minnesota Legislature directed DHS to implement Minn. Stat. §256S.191, which allows people age 65 and older to access to budget exceptions when they discharge from a hospital with high care needs.

MDH Announces Assisted Living Grant

On December 31, 2025 by Shelli Bakken

The Minnesota Department of Health (MDH) has announced the upcoming launch of the Assisted Living Competitive Grant Program, established under new legislation effective Jan. 1, 2026 (see Minnesota Statutes, section 144G.31). This program supports projects and initiatives that improve resident quality of care and outcomes in assisted living settings licensed under Minnesota Statutes, chapter 144G, or organizations with experience in assisted living operations, compliance, resident needs, or best practices.

Long-term Care Leaders Requested to Complete Professional Practice Analysis Survey

On December 18, 2025 by Bobbie Guidry

The National Association of Long-Term Care Boards (NAB) has launched the 2025-26 Professional Practice Analysis (PPA) survey. A PPA, sometimes referred to as a Job Analysis, is the practice of gathering and analyzing details about a particular job, such as responsibilities, day-to-day duties, qualifications, etc.

Bipartisan Bill Seeks to Combat Nursing Shortage by Using Unissued Visas

On October 30, 2025 by Anna Mowry

The Healthcare Workforce Resilience Act has been reintroduced – A federal bill that proposes to recapture up to 40,000 previously authorized but unused immigrant visas—25,000 for nurses and 15,000 for physicians.
